Education refers to the discipline that is concerned with methods of teaching and learning in schools or school-like environments, as opposed to various nonformal and informal means of socialization.

What is education short essay?
Education is the process of learning new things and acquiring knowledge. It can be formal, such as in schools, or informal, such as through life experiences.Education has many benefits, including providing people with the skills and knowledge they need to succeed in life. It can also help to promote social and economic development, and to reduce poverty and inequality.Education is a human right, and everyone should have access to it. However, in many parts of the world, including many developing countries, education is not a priority, and many children do not have access to quality education. This is one of the biggest challenges facing the world today.
